Facebook-feed

stemmer
0

Jeg prøver å legge inn noe på en facebook brukere mate og så etterpå omdirigere brukeren til en annen side, men det virker som siden bare fortsetter omlasting uten Love for å sende brukeren feed.

FB.Connect.showFeedDialog(1111111, null, null, null, null, null, redirectTo(), null, null);
function redirectTo()
{
     window.top.location = /mywebsite;
}

hvis jeg bare ringe showet fôret med id det fungerer.

    FB.Connect.showFeedDialog(1111111, null, null, null, null, null, redirectTo(), null, null);

Alle som vet hvorfor de første linjene med kode holder laste siden på en infinitiv loop?

Publisert på 12/05/2009 klokken 14:21
kilden bruker
På andre språk...                            


1 svar

stemmer
2

Når du registrerer tilbakeringingsfunksjonen, vil du passere referansen til funksjon og faktisk ikke kalle funksjonen. Fjern parentesene fra redirectTo i første linje:

FB.Connect.showFeedDialog(1111111, null, null, null, null, null, redirectTo, null, null);
function redirectTo(){
     window.top.location = "/mywebsite";
}
Svarte 12/05/2009 kl. 14:28
kilden bruker

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more